Born from the expertise of teams who have led EPC and O&M services at Voltalia since 2005, Renvolt delivers high-performance service solutions to accelerate the global energy transition. We specialize in solar and storage, operating as a trusted global provider with a strong international track record.

 

With local teams in 14 countries, more than 400 employees worldwide, and 24/7 support, we partner with clients across all regions to ensure success. Renvolt is supported by a strong investment group that provides long-term stability and reinforces our commitment to sustainable growth.

 

Our portfolio includes 5.6 GW built and under construction, and 1.9 GW already in operation, demonstrating our capability and reliability in delivering large-scale renewable projects.

YOUR MISSIONS

The Systems Engineer position involves developing systems and requires advanced expertise in data processing, analytics, and full-cycle software and web development with Python, HTML, CSS, JavaScript, Pandas, ETL processes, and CI/CD using Jenkins.

The main responsibilities include:

  • Design, develop, and maintain solutions for renewable energy operation, monitoring and performance optimization;
  • Execution of projects to be developed by the Performance team by using Agile methodology, making sure that the best valuable product is being delivered;
  • Development of web platforms, software and processing algorithms based upon the different business line needs;
  • Data processing and analytics;
  • Data Extraction, Treatment and Load (ETL);
  • Full cycle software and web development using Python, HTML, CSS, JavaScript, Pandas and others;
  • Build Web front ends using modern frameworks (e.g. JavaScript, Bootstrap, Tailwind);
  • Interact with modern API technologies (e.g. REST, JSON, OAUTH, SOAP);
  • Build scalable APIs and data services using modern Python frameworks (e.g., Django, FastAPI);
  • Develop and deploy serverless applications in a cloud-native environment;
  • Implement secure coding practices aligned with industry standards (OWASP, secure SDLC principles);
  • Design and maintain CI/CD pipelines to enable automated build, test, and deployment processes;
  • Monitor system reliability, performance, and security posture;
  • Enforce software engineering best practices.

 

 

QUALIFICATIONS & EXPERIENCES

The ideal candidate will be/have:

  • A background in Computer Science, Informatics, or a related field;
  • Solid programming skills in Python and modern web technologies such as Django, H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and Bootstrap;
  • Experience building data-driven applications and visualizations (e.g., Highcharts or similar tools);
  • Hands-on experience with relational databases such as SQL Server or MySQL;
  • Strong communication skills with fluency in English and/or Portuguese.
